Limit question: lim x--&gt;pi ((e^sinx)-1)/(x-pi)
aleksandr82 [10.1K]
\displaystyle\lim_{x\to\pi}\dfrac{e^{\sin x}-1}{x-\pi}

Notice that if f(x)=e^{\sin x}, then f(\pi)=e^{\sin\pi}=e^0=1. Recall the definition of the derivative of a function f(x) at a point x=c:

f'(c):=\displaystyle\lim_{x\to c}\frac{f(x)-f(c)}{x-c}

So the value of this limit is exactly the value of the derivative of f(x)=e^{\sin x} at x=\pi.

You have

f'(x)=\cos x\,e^{\sin x}\implies f'(\pi)=\cos\pi\,e^{\sin\pi}=-1
